Stoplight Loosejaw
The stoplight loosejaws are small, deep-sea Barbeled dragonfish, dragonfishes of the genus ''Malacosteus'', classified either within the subfamily Malacosteinae of the family Stomiidae, or in the separate family Malacosteidae. They are found worldwide, outside of the Arctic and Subantarctic, in the mesopelagic zone, mesopelagic and Bathypelagic zone, bathypelagic zones, below a depth of . This genus once contained three nominal species: ''M. niger'' (the type), ''M. choristodactylus'', and ''M. danae'', with the validity of the latter two species being challenged by different authors at various times. In 2007, Kenaley examined over 450 stoplight loosejaw specimens and revised the genus to contain two species, ''M. niger'' and the new ''M. australis''. ''Malacosteus'' and the related genera ''Aristostomias'', ''Chirostomias pliopterus, Chirostomias'' and ''Pachystomias'' are the only fishes that produce red bioluminescence. William Orville Ayres
William Orville Ayres (September 11, 1817 – April 30, 1887) was an American physician and ichthyologist. Born in Connecticut, he studied to become a Physician, doctor at Yale University School of Medicine. Life and career Ayers, the son of Jared and Dinah (Benedict) Ayres, was born in New Canaan, Connecticut, New Canaan, Conn, September 11, 1817. He graduated from Yale College in 1837. For fifteen years after graduation he was employed as a teacher as follows in Berlin, Connecticut, Berlin, Conn. (1837–38), Miller Place, New York, Miller's Place, L. I. (1838–41), East Hartford, Connecticut, East Hartford, Conn. (1842–44), Sag Harbor, New York, Sag Harbor, L. I. (1844–47), and Boston, Mass (1845–52). He began the study of medicine in Boston, and in 1854 received the degree of M.D. from Yale College. Tooth
A tooth (: teeth) is a hard, calcified structure found in the jaws (or mouths) of many vertebrates and used to break down food. Some animals, particularly carnivores and omnivores, also use teeth to help with capturing or wounding prey, tearing food, for defensive purposes, to intimidate other animals often including their own, or to carry prey or their young. The roots of teeth are covered by gums. Teeth are not made of bone, but rather of multiple tissues of varying density and hardness that originate from the outermost embryonic germ layer, the ectoderm. The general structure of teeth is similar across the vertebrates, although there is considerable variation in their form and position. The teeth of mammals have deep roots, and this pattern is also found in some fish, and in crocodilians. Lower Fish Jaw
Most bony fishes have two sets of jaws made mainly of bone. The primary oral jaws open and close the mouth, and a second set of pharyngeal jaws are positioned at the back of the throat. The oral jaws are used to capture and manipulate prey by biting and crushing. The pharyngeal jaws, so-called because they are positioned within the pharynx, are used to further process the food and move it from the mouth to the stomach. Cartilaginous fishes, such as sharks and Batoidea, rays, have one set of oral jaws made mainly of cartilage. They do not have pharyngeal jaws. Generally jaws are Articulation (anatomy), articulated and oppose vertically, comprising an upper jaw and a lower jaw and can bear numerous ordered teeth. Cartilaginous fishes grow multiple sets ''(polyphyodont)'' and replace teeth as they wear by moving new teeth laterally from the medial jaw surface in a conveyor-belt fashion. Nostril
A nostril (or naris , : nares ) is either of the two orifices of the nose. They enable the entry and exit of air and other gasses through the nasal cavities. In birds and mammals, they contain branched bones or cartilages called turbinates, whose function is to warm air on inhalation and remove moisture on exhalation. Fish do not breathe through noses, but they do have two small holes used for smelling, which can also be referred to as nostrils (with the exception of Cyclostomi, which have just one nostril). In humans, the nasal cycle is the normal ultradian cycle of each nostril's blood vessels becoming engorged in swelling, then shrinking. The nostrils are separated by the septum. The septum can sometimes be deviated, causing one nostril to appear larger than the other. Snout
A snout is the protruding portion of an animal's face, consisting of its nose, mouth, and jaw. In many animals, the structure is called a muzzle, Rostrum (anatomy), rostrum, beak or proboscis. The wet furless surface around the nostrils of the nose of many mammals is called the rhinarium (colloquially this is the "cold wet snout" of some mammals). The rhinarium is often associated with a stronger sense of olfaction. Variation Snouts are found on many mammals in a variety of shapes. Some animals, including ursines and great cats, have box-like snouts, while others, like shrews, have pointed snouts. Pig snouts are flat and cylindrical. Primates Strepsirrhine primates have muzzles, as do baboons. Great apes have reduced muzzles, with the exception being human beings, whose face does not have protruding jaws nor a snout but merely a human nose. Diel Vertical Migration
Diel vertical migration (DVM), also known as diurnal vertical migration, is a pattern of movement used by some organisms, such as copepods, living in the ocean and in lakes. The adjective "diel" ( IPA: , ) comes from , and refers to a 24-hour period. The migration occurs when organisms move up to the uppermost layer of the water at night and return to the bottom of the daylight zone of the oceans or to the dense, bottom layer of lakes during the day. DVM is important to the functioning of deep-sea food webs and the biologically-driven sequestration of carbon. In terms of biomass, DVM is the largest synchronous migration in the world. It is not restricted to any one taxon, as examples are known from crustaceans (copepods), molluscs (squid), and ray-finned fishes (trout). The phenomenon may be advantageous for a number of reasons, most typically to access food and to avoid predators. Mesopelagic Zone
The mesopelagic zone (Greek μέσον, middle), also known as the middle pelagic or twilight zone, is the part of the pelagic zone that lies between the photic epipelagic and the aphotic bathypelagic zones. It is defined by light, and begins at the depth where only 1% of incident light reaches and ends where there is no light; the depths of this zone are between approximately below the ocean surface. The mesopelagic zone occupies about 60% of the planet's surface and about 20% of the ocean's volume, amounting to a large part of the total biosphere. It hosts a diverse biological community that includes bristlemouths, blobfish, bioluminescent jellyfish, giant squid, and myriad other unique organisms adapted to live in a low-light environment. It has long captivated the imagination of scientists, artists and writers; deep sea creatures are prominent in popular culture. Indian Ocean
The Indian Ocean is the third-largest of the world's five oceanic divisions, covering or approximately 20% of the water area of Earth#Surface, Earth's surface. It is bounded by Asia to the north, Africa to the west and Australia (continent), Australia to the east. To the south it is bounded by the Southern Ocean or Antarctica, depending on the definition in use. The Indian Ocean has large marginal or regional seas, including the Andaman Sea, the Arabian Sea, the Bay of Bengal, and the Laccadive Sea. Geologically, the Indian Ocean is the youngest of the oceans, and it has distinct features such as narrow continental shelf, continental shelves. Its average depth is 3,741 m. It is the warmest ocean, with a significant impact on global climate due to its interaction with the atmosphere. Its waters are affected by the Indian Ocean Walker circulation, resulting in unique oceanic currents and upwelling patterns.
